From Merlo to the Valle de Calamuchita. Our next destination after Merlo. Was the valley of Calamuchita. We took a short cut over the mountains. This took us past an observatory and enabled us to by-pass the city of Cordoba altogether, bringing us directly into the town of Alta Gracia, the site of an historic Jesuit Estancia.
